On the So-Called Genitive Absolute and Its Use Especially in the Attic Orators:

Edward H. Spieker provides a linguistic analysis of the genitive absolute, one of the key constructions of the Greek language and often compared to the Latin Ablative Absolute despite some key dissimilarities
